Mot clé Risques Politique/planification Système d'alerte précoce Fonds spécial Contrat/accord Aire géographique Afrique, Atlantique Sud, Afrique Méridionale Résumé These Regulations implement provisions of the Disaster Risk Management Act with respect to, among other things, disaster risk management plans, investigation and reporting of a disaster, budgeting for disaster risk management, the national disaster fund, training for disasters, co-operative agreements by Prime Minister, the code of practice in disaster risk management, volunteers, compensation of losses, and offences and penalties. A disaster risk management plan must in addition to other matters prescribed by the Act, make provision for a variety of matters defined by these Regulations including the promotion of partnership in disaster risk management with relevant key stakeholder. The co-operation agreement referred to in section 54 of the Act may include matters defined by these Regulations.
